RESPONSIBLITIES
Accounts Receivable
- Responsible for the daily creation and processing of customer billings/invoices along with related payment application against those charges and processes refunds requests for over payments as required.
- Reviews daily charges/vouchers received at NPC Revenue Producing facilities; verifies contractual rates to billings to ensure compliance.
- Completes on-line customer reporting requirements and reconciles information to ensure correct billing and sales allocations.
- Responsible for maintaining and processing customer credit card charges (recurring and non-recurring) against outstanding account balances while adhering to PCI compliance polices.
- Generates and balances monthly aged trial balance report and applies entries as necessary. Distributes report to appropriate managers with respective comments regarding delinquent accounts and payment status.
- Reconcile the Accounts Receivable ledger and control log to ensure that all billings and payments are accounted for and properly posted. Researches any discrepancies by checking invoices, sales receipts and bank deposit records. Maintains detailed customer files and miscellaneous Accounts Receivable schedules and lists.
Accounts Payable
- Receive & Match Purchase Orders and vouchers, accounting for any discrepancies to provide accuracy for vendor payments.
- Performs data entry from Purchase Orders and Invoices including invoice dates, terms, apply dates, applicable taxes, etc.
- Accountable for investigating past due invoices and outstanding purchase orders/invoices.
- Issues and maintains new vendor numbers/files. Confirms terms, method of payment, tax codes, addresses and other related information.
- Assists with the preparing of weekly cheque processing, pay register, abstracts, adjustments, and accurate filing of invoices.
